Can I live in my holiday home?
No, your holiday home cannot be your primary residence. Proof of address must be shown at the time of purchase and you must vacate your property during our winter closure each year.

What’s the difference between log cabins, lodges and holiday homes?
The main difference between a log cabin, lodge and holiday home is the size and style. Lodges tend to be wider than holiday homes, providing a larger more open-plan living area. Log cabins, as the name would suggest, are wooden clad whereas holiday homes and lodges are usually clad by some form of composite weatherboarding.

How long is the License Agreement at Merley House Holiday Park?
Holiday homes come with a 15-year Licence Agreement, whereas lodges come with a 30-year agreement.
At the end of your License Agreement, you can either upgrade your home, or move it offsite. Providing your holiday home is maintained to a high standard you can also or extended your term by another 10 or 20 years.

How are utilities charged?
Utilities are not included in your annual site fees. We bill for water, sewage and waste disposal and electric twice a year in January and September. All homes are individually metered.
Only a small number of our holiday homes have mains gas, the majority have gas bottles. Replacement gas bottles can be purchased on-site.
